Earth Tone – Organic Sans Family

Text promoting the "Earth & Tone" font, featuring neutral beige tones with ceramic vases. Font styles include Light, Regular, and Bold.

Earth Tone is a beautifully handcrafted sans serif family that brings natural, organic vibes to your designs.

It comes in three weights (Light, Regular, Bold) and works perfectly for branding, logos, quotes, or any project needing that authentic handmade touch. Plus, it supports multilingual characters, numbers, and symbols.

Boho Floral Dingbat

The image showcases "Boho Floral" doodle dingbat font with colorful floral graphics, two butterflies, a pen, and a rustic wood slice.

Boho Floral Dingbat feels like a relaxed, hand drawn collection of floral symbols ready to charm logos, packaging, and craft projects.

It includes 62 doodle icons in TTF OTF and EOT formats, covers basic Latin characters, and has a warm, artisanal vibe.

Script font or serif font. Which suits boho style better?

Selecting fonts is something we all do regularly. For boho projects, a script font is often best made beautiful by a touch of elegance or the hint of softness.

Think wedding invitation designs or personal logos here. A monoline script font with soft, gentle curves works especially well in this case.

On the other hand, a serif font adds structure. A ligature serif font or even a retro serif font, when combined with gentle colors and spacing, can create the modern boho look.

I like to make a serif font the heading, and a softly written font serves as accents. This duo yields a tremendous contrast, yet still feels like a single entity, which is boho in spirit.

Using font duos to create a cohesive boho aesthetic

A combination of two, the font duo is the easiest way to achieve a finishing touch on a boho style dress Handwritten fonts can be mixed with a sans serif font that is more simple.

Or pick a serif typeface and match it with a slightly scripty one. This introduces both prominence and variety into your design without making it cluttered.

The right combination of fonts will have a similar mood and weight. One font gives personality while the other provides balance.

This is what makes a design appear polished and professional while retaining that gorgeous boho feeling.

How to choose the right boho font for your project

The very first step when looking at fonts is to consider what you will be using it for. Is this font for a logo, a wedding invitation, product packaging design, or social media graphics design?

Every use requires a slightly different approach to choosing a font that matches your design intentions.

Now consider what you want the design to express: smooth and gentle? earthy and solid? full of vitality?

Better to use a font just right for the emotions you aim at than the latest in fashion. Good typesetting should help deliver your message, not overshadow it.
